Nothing Ear 1 wireless earbuds launched in India

Nothing has unveiled its first product, Nothing Ear 1 TWS earbuds, in India. The earbuds, which features an iconic new design, excellent battery life and active noise cancellation among others, will be available in the country for Rs 5,999 on Flipkart from August 17 at 12 pm, alongside 45 markets including the US and UK. Additionally, the earbuds come with a mobile app for Android and iOS that lets users customise various settings on the device.

Poco X3 GT smartphone launched globally

Poco X3 GT has been launched globally as an upgraded version of the standard Poco X3 from September last year. The smartphone offers two RAM and storage configurations as well as three color options – Black, White, and Green. Key specs of this new device include a 6.6-inch 120Hz display, a 5000mAh battery capacity and MediaTek Dimensity 1100 SoC. Coming to the price, you can get Poco X3 GT in USD 200 (approx. Rs 22,200) for the base 8GB + 128GB model. The phone will be available in Southeast Asia, the Middle East, Latin America, and Africa.

Mozilla VPN unveils major security boost

Mozilla VPN users will now be able to select which apps they want to use the company’s VPN service as Mozilla has unveiled a new split tunneling feature. It allows users to split Internet traffic and encrypted VPN tunnel and which one connects to the open network. Split tunneling is now available on Mozilla VPN on both Android and iOS. When enabled, people can prioritize how each app connects to the Internet when VPN is turned on.

Instagram Reels now support 60-second videos

Social media platform Instagram is now letting users create considerable longer videos. Users can now upload 60-second longer videos on Reel, which is double the previous limit of 30-second. This aim, aimed at rival TikTok and others is a calculated one. Also, this update adds functionality for a caption sticker on Reels that transcribes audio to text. Currently, the caption sticker is only available in a handful of English-speaking countries, but the platform says they plan to expand to additional languages and countries soon.

Oppo Reno 6 4G with Snapdragon 720G SoC launched

Oppo Reno 6 4G specifications and price have been revealed as the smartphone is officially launched in Indonesia. The new device looks similar to its Reno 6 Pro 5G sibling with quad rear cameras at the back and a hole-punch display. It now gets a Qualcomm Snapdragon 720G SoC instead of MediaTek Dimensity 900 chipset on the 5G model. The Oppo Reno 6 4G price in Indonesia is IDR 5,199,000 (approx Rs 26,700) and will be available in Stellar Black and Aurora color options.
